In yet another proud moment for the region, Ace Assam swimmer Elvis Ali Hazarika has become the first from the Northeast to swim across the Catalina Channel.

Elvis swam from the United States to Mexico, which is approximately 20 miles by sea. It took Elvis 10 hours and 51 minutes to cross the channel.

The former international swimmer was accompanied by Rimo Saha, another former international swimmer, in the feat.
